My approach to tutoring:
When I tutor, my main goal is to help students actually understand what they’re learning, not just memorize it for an exam. A lot of biology and health-related material can feel overwhelming at first, so I focus on breaking things down into clear, logical steps and explaining why things work the way they do. My background in both biology and SAT tutoring has shaped how I teach — I care just as much about understanding the material as I do about knowing how to approach questions efficiently and confidently.
I try to meet students where they are. Some people want a slower, discussion-based approach, while others want lots of practice problems and structure. I adjust my pace and style based on what helps each student learn best.
How I teach:
I use a mix of explanation, discussion, and practice. I often draw connections between topics so the material feels less fragmented, and I use examples from real life, medicine, or research when it helps things make sense. From my experience with SAT tutoring, I also spend time teaching students how to think through questions, spot common traps, and manage their time — skills that apply across many exams, not just standardized tests.
I don’t rush through material. If something isn’t clicking, we slow down and work through it until it does.
What a typical lesson looks like:
Most sessions start with a quick check-in and a review of anything we covered before. Then we focus on one or two main topics, going over the concepts first before moving into practice questions or problems. I’ll often ask students to explain ideas back in their own words so I can see what makes sense and what still feels confusing. We usually end by going over what to practice next or how to review between sessions.
